If i was after a short shaven look with FUE as well as SMP which would i need to do first?
Logic says to me that the scalp pigmentation is best done first because the transplant would need a year to grow.
What worries me is the scabbing after the FUE surgery and the incisions during the transplant, could these damage the SMP underneath?
Which way round is best?

We offer both SMP and FUE hair restoration.

To answer your question.

Have SMP done first. Then wait about 2-3 months before having an FUE hair transplant.

Going the other way around would mean waiting about a year after a FUE hair transplant in order to get SMP done.

I imagine it's to let things heal properly..Although it's not major surgery a tattoo is still a wound and takes time to heal properly. I'm sure a few months won't make much difference in the grand scheme of things dude and it's better to be safe than sorry. Not worth risking damaging the SMP or risking any healing problems with the FUE by having surgery too quickly imo.
